[QUOTE="Geoffc, post: 95947, member: 8705"] I've tried it again on various AF settings and it struggles in very dark low contrast situations even with 1.8 and 2.8 glass attached. The D300s just snaps in, in the same setting. If I attach my SB900 with the red focus light enabled it is very quick again. I will see if it's a problem in actual use, but it's ironic that the 300 is good at AF in low light but is noisy at high ISO and the D600 is the opposite. Also, at 75 clicks in I have the dust problem. The D300 is 16000 clicks in and is like new!! I will see if it's ok after a couple of thousand. [/QUOTE]
